On Friday we had the privilege of attending a beautiful wedding at the Fredrick Meijer gardens in Grand Rapids.
If you ever have a chance to visit here you must do so.
We headed to the venu early so we could have the chance to look around the gardens.
Not only is it an amazing botanical collection they also have one of the most amazing and extensive modern sculptural collections in the United States.
Primarily we wanted to check out the Japanese gardens.
It’s the newest and biggest section and it is absolutely stunning.
